I'm a Bedroom/basement Detroit Hip-Hop producer that goes above the norm. I enjoy mutilating samples and creating something out of nothing. I go beyond simply finding a sample and adding some drums to it. My idea of chopping is deeper than simple rearranging a hot loop, and my drums are usually all over the place, sloppy, unquantized, but it doesn't sound like gym shoes in a dryer.
If you enjoy artists like Madlib, or J-Dilla, than chances are you will enjoy what I have to offer. I consider my style to be deeper than most, and very original. The act of simply adding drums to a sample is very old to me, and discovering new ways on developing a raw style is very intriguing. I work with MPC's, vinyl, and synthesizers while recording 2-track to a cd-burner, or(as of recently) a free program called Audacity. ProTools is too complicated, I always need to watch the supplied DVD for every function that I need to use and this gets in the way of creativity. Please don't expect pristine audible quality, this is gutta music that I'm sure you will enjoy. :)
